  2. Years ago a fair was held four times a year a quarter of a miles south west of Kilmurry village. It was held in Patk Sheehan's field, opposite the Protestant Church. The biggest fair was held in September to coincide with the big "pattern" which was held at St Mary's Well in Cnoc A Tobair on the 8th of that month. Later on the fair was held in Reilly's field now owned by Mr. J.T. Kelleher. The fair ceased to be held at the advent of Railways. There are paving stones along the side of the road in front of the R. C. Church and these were utilized for loading pigs
